Description
Obol from Sasanian Empire. Issued from 276 to 293. Struck in Silver (.900). Measures 14 mm and weighs 0.6 g.
- Obverse
- Bust of Varhran II right, wearing winged crown with korymbos, pellet, crescent, pellet behind korymbos
- Reverse
- Fire altar, flanked by two attendants, the one on left wearing winged crown with korymbos, the other wearing mural crown.
